Detecting AI-generated content can be difficult as AI technologies are becoming more sophisticated. However, there are a few signs that can indicate that the content is generated by AI:
1. Lack of human-like errors: AI-generated content may lack the typical spelling or grammar mistakes that humans make. This can be a red flag that the content is not created by a human writer.
2. Unusual language or tone: AI-generated content may have a robotic or unnatural tone to it. If the content seems too perfect or lacks a human touch, it could be a sign that it is generated by AI.
3. Repetitive patterns: AI algorithms might produce content that follows a consistent structure or format. If you notice that the content is repetitive in nature, it could be a sign that it is generated by AI.
4. Uncommon or irrelevant information: AI algorithms may generate content that includes irrelevant or unusual information. If you come across content that contains incorrect facts or irrelevant details, it could be a sign that it is AI-generated.
5. Use of predefined templates: AI-generated content may follow a specific template or format. If you notice that the content is structured in a predictable way, it could be a sign that it is generated by AI.
While these signs can help you identify AI-generated content, it is important to note that AI technologies are constantly evolving and becoming more sophisticated. It may be challenging to detect AI-generated content in some cases, so it’s important to use your judgment and consider the context in which the content is presented.
